Quick answer
For long-term driveway planning, RKG's own service comparisons list block paving at 25+ years, resin at 15–25 years, tarmac at 15–20 years and shingle as a stone surface that lasts indefinitely but usually needs top-ups every 5–7 years. Those figures assume the base, edging and drainage are suitable for the site.
Driveway lifespan by surface
| Surface | Published lifespan notes | What protects it |
|---|---|---|
| Block paving | 25+ years in RKG's driveway comparison tables. | 150mm MOT Type 1 sub-base, geotextile membrane, herringbone or suitable pattern, concrete-haunched edge restraint and joint maintenance. |
| Tarmac | 15–20 years before resurfacing for a correctly engineered hot-rolled tarmac driveway. | Full sub-base, correct binder and surface courses, stable kerb or hidden steel edging, drainage away from the highway, and seal coats every 3–5 years. |
| Resin bound | 15–25 years with a sound sub-base and UV-stable resin. | Well-drained existing base or new prepared base, correct resin depth, UV-stable materials, secure edging and regular checks that the surface remains free-draining. |
| Shingle and gravel | The stone itself is effectively permanent; most drives need a fresh top-up every 5–7 years. Edging and weed membrane typically last 15–20 years. | Angular stone, heavy-duty membrane, stable edges and honeycomb grid where slopes, daily use or wheelchair access make migration more likely. |
The hidden work matters more than the finish
A surface with a strong lifespan on paper can fail early if the preparation is vague. RKG's quote and sub-base guidance repeatedly points back to excavation depth, MOT Type 1, compaction, membranes, drainage routes and edge restraint. Ask for those details in the written quote rather than relying on a surface name alone.
How maintenance changes the answer
Maintenance is not the same for every driveway. Block paving benefits from washing, re-sanding and sealing. Tarmac can be kept fresher with seal coats. Resin needs drainage and surface cleanliness protected. Shingle needs raking, top-ups and stable edging. Choose by use, not just years
Lifespan should sit alongside daily use. Vans, turning areas, sloped drives, front-garden conversions and tight access can all change the best surface choice. Tarmac and block paving are often stronger fits for heavier daily use, resin is a premium permeable option when the base is suitable, and shingle is cost-effective and permeable when migration is controlled.
